Common Misconceptions About Assessment Frequency
One typical mistaken belief regarding evaluation regularity is that performing evaluations just when there show up signs of insects suffices. While waiting on noticeable indicators might seem like an economical technique, bugs can often stay concealed up until their numbers have considerably boosted, making it more difficult and a lot more pricey to eradicate them.
Routine evaluations, even in the absence of obvious pest discoveries, can assist spot invasions in their early stages, avoiding considerable damages to your home.
